#d6e6c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6e6c5 is composed of 83.9% red, 90.2%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.3%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 89.1 degrees, a saturation of 39.8% and a lightness of 83.7%. #d6e6c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#adcd8b.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#d6e6c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6e6c5 has RGB values of R:214, G:230,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 14083781.
